Comprehensive Guide to checking account change notice

Understanding the Checking Account Change Notice

The Checking Account Change Notice is a essential form used to formally request the closure of a checking account with a financial institution. This document is primarily intended for account holders who need to indicate their intent to close their accounts accurately and efficiently. Filling out this form correctly is crucial, as inaccuracies could lead to delays or complications in processing the closure.
This form typically requires information such as the account holder's details and the financial institution's information, including the current checking account number. Ensuring completeness in the information provided is vital for a smooth transition.

Purpose and Benefits of the Checking Account Change Notice

The necessity to submit the Checking Account Change Notice arises from various situations, such as dissatisfaction with service or a change in financial needs. Utilizing this form brings several advantages, not only for the account holders but also for the financial institutions involved.
By formally submitting a checking account closure request, account holders ensure that their account is closed properly, reducing potential fees or unauthorized transactions in the future. Financial institutions benefit from officially acknowledging closure requests, allowing them to keep accurate records and maintain security.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the Checking Account Change Notice

When filling out the Checking Account Change Notice, each section requires specific information:
  • Personal Information: Include your full name, address, and contact details.
  • Account Details: Provide the checking account number and any necessary identifying information.
  • Closure Instructions: Clearly indicate how you wish to handle your account balance.
Common mistakes to avoid include leaving fields blank, using incorrect account information, or failing to review the document before submission.

Submission Methods and Next Steps after Filing the Checking Account Change Notice

Once the Checking Account Change Notice is filled out, it is important to know how to submit the completed form. Options typically include:
  • Electronically via the financial institution's designated email or portal.
  • By mailing a physical copy to the appropriate address provided by the bank.
After submission, tracking the status of your request may involve contacting customer service. It's advisable to keep a copy of the submitted form and any confirmation received for record-keeping purposes.

Any account holder at a financial institution who wishes to close their checking account can utilize the Checking Account Change Notice. It's pertinent that you are the named account holder and have access to the account.
You will need your personal details, current checking account number, financial institution's name, and your preferences for handling the account balance, whether by mail or deposit to another account.
You can submit the form by either mailing it directly to your financial institution or electronically through pdfFiller, if accepted. Be sure to follow your bank's specific submission guidelines.
While there are generally no strict deadlines, it’s advisable to submit the Checking Account Change Notice promptly to ensure your account closure is processed as soon as possible, especially if you have any upcoming transactions.
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, providing incorrect account details, and failing to sign the document. Carefully reviewing the form before submission can help prevent these errors.
Processing times vary by financial institution but typically range from a few days to a couple of weeks. Always check with your bank for their specific processing times.
No, notarization is not required for the Checking Account Change Notice. However, it must be signed by the account holder to validate the request.
